There's no place like home for Plainview, who bounced back after a loss on the road on Friday. They came out on top against the Hueytown Golden Gophers by a score of 6-1 on Friday. This was a revenge game for the Bears: when they faced off against the Golden Gophers on Friday, they had to take a 1-0 loss.

Plainview's victory was their 22nd straight at home dating back to last season, which pushed their record up to 14-5. The home wins came thanks in part to their hitting performance across that stretch, as they averaged 10.4 runs over those games. As for Hueytown, their defeat dropped their record down to 16-11.
Plainview has already played their next match, a 6-0 victory against Valley Head on the 4th. As for Hueytown, they also didn't take long to hit the field again: they've already played their next contest, a 6-0 loss against Springville on the 5th.
